Short stories: Guardian angels

I have always believed in angels, and that we have a special angel watching over us as we live our daily routine called life.

The passing of my Mother hit me very hard. She was diagnosed with Cancer of the lungs, and died only 2 weeks later. Complications from her lung biopsy were to blame. She was so very strong, kind, and full of love. I still miss her so very much, even though she's been gone now for over 21 years. I've learned to deal with the loss of my Mother, through prayers, and also believing that she was watching over me constantly.



My ex-husband's Grandmother, and my Mother shared the same day of birth. January 11th. Different years, but the same day. Both beautiful women. I woke up early on the morning of February 7, 2004. A feeling of dread came over me, and I said to my husband that I felt that Lois was going to die that day. She had been put into a home for the elderly months ago. No phone calls, or changes in her health were passed along the communication lines, but I felt something was wrong...

Sure enough, at 9:15 PM, February 7th 2004, Lois was called Home to our Lord's Kingdom. What struck me even more, was the fact that now not only did these two women share the same day of birth, now they also shared the same day of passing. February 7th.

Chills ran through my body as this realization came over me, starting from my feet, and slowly moving upwards.. What are the odds of such a thing happening? Was this a sign from my guardian angel, telling me that she will also come for me when my time comes? Was this a message that there is something else, something better after this life? I broke down in tears as this impossible message was relayed to my soul. The sorrow that I carried all those years for my Mother's loss, now lifted up from me, releasing me from it's bondage. I never felt closer to my Mother since her passing, as I did at that moment.

I believe even more since this happened, that there is something more for us. We don't just disappear when we die. Our loved one's, our guardian angels come for us, and guide us to our Heaven, in God's Kingdom, where we will be united, forever.
